Mohammed Bin Rashid University of Medicine and Health Sciences (MBRU; www.mbru.ac.ae) is part of Dubai Health, the first integrated academic health system in the UAE. Dubai Health seeks to strengthen Dubai as a global leader in health care, medical education, research, and scientific innovation, to enhance the capabilities of Dubai's healthcare sector. Dubai Health is managing and operating 54 sites, including 6 government hospitals, 26 ambulatory health centers, 20 medical fitness centers, Mohammed Bin Rashid University of Medicine and Health Sciences (MBRU), and Al Jalila Foundation.

ROLE PURPOSE:

The Postdoctoral Research Fellow will lead computational research supporting therapeutic development programs, with a focus on antisense oligonucleotides (ASOs), RNA biology, and functional genomics.

The role involves multi-omics data analysis, integration of transcriptomic and genomic datasets, and development of computational pipelines to support target discovery, validation, and translational research initiatives.

Strategic Responsibilities:

  • Contribute to building machine learning models and computational strategy for therapeutic and functional genomics programs
  • Build deep neural network-based models to ssupport data-driven decision making for target prioritization and validation
  • Collaborate with wet lab teams to integrate experimental and computational workflows
  • Identify and implement advanced bioinformatics tools and pipelines

Core Responsibilities:

  • Building machine learning models using multi-omics data for neuro-oncology projects
  • Analyze RNA-seq, long-read sequencing (PacBio), and other omics datasets
  • Develop and maintain bioinformatics pipelines for transcriptomics and genomics
  • Perform differential expression, pathway analysis, and functional annotation
  • Integrate multi-omics datasets (genomics, transcriptomics, proteomics where applicable)
  • Support ASO target identification and validation through data-driven approaches
  • Collaborate with lab scientists to interpret experimental results
  • Maintain reproducible workflows (R/Python, workflow managers)
  • Contribute to publications, grants, and scientific outputs
  • Present findings internally and at scientific meetings

Minimum Qualifications:

  • PhD in Bioinformatics, Computational Biology, Genomics, or related field
  • Strong experience in RNA-seq and transcriptomic data analysis
  • Proficiency in R and/or Python
  • Experience with NGS data analysis pipelines
  • Ability to work independently and design computational workflows

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with long-read sequencing (PacBio, Iso-Seq)
  • Exposure to therapeutics, RNA biology, or functional genomics
  • Familiarity with multi-omics integration
  • Experience working with clinical or translational datasets
  • Publication record in relevant field
  • Written and spoken English is essential, Arabic is preferred

Years of Experience:

PhD in machine learning or artificial intelligence, bioinformatics, computational biology, genomics, or related field or a related field from an accredited institute/college/university.

Minimum 1 – 2 years of relevant post-doctoral experience.
